YORDAN MOVES UP TWO WEIGHT DIVISIONS IN QUEST FOR IBO LIGHTWEIGHT TITLE

PhilBoxing.com




Indonesia?s tough Daud Yordan who lost his IBO featherweight title by a 12th round TKO to South Africa?s 32 year old Simpiwe Vetyeka last April 14 in Jakarta will move up two divisions to face Argentina?s Daniel Eduardo Brizuela in Perth, Western Australia?s Metro City on Saturday.

The fight which will be refereed by internationally respected Angeles City based New Zealander Bruce McTavish is expected to test Yordan who says he is ready for a bigger challenge in the lightweight division and a chance to become the first Indonesian two-division world champion.

The 26 year old Yordan told the Jakarta Globe ?It will be history if I can win the bout. I will be the first Indonesian to win world titles in two different classes. I always have motivation and each motivation is special for me.?

It will be Daud?s first bout after losing his title to Vetyeka at Jakarta?s Tennis Indoor Senayan on April 14.

He has been in Perth for two weeks training at Harry?s Gym, owned by Chris John?s trainer Craig Christian.

During the final stages of his preparation the Indonesian revealed ?I have a two-hour training regimen now, which has six to eight rounds. I did my big preparation in my hometown.?

Daud, his trainer Damianus Yordan and Christian have reviewed Brizuela?s previous fights and have drawn up a strategy to overcome the Argentine WBO Latino lightweight champion who is 27 years old and has a record of 25-1-2 with 8 knockouts.

Yordan said ??I know what to do. But I know he has advantages as he has been fighting lightweight for some time while it?s my first bout in the (lightweight) class.?

He noted that Brizuela ?has a good reputation as the International Boxing Federation Latino lightweight champion. I will try to be more aggressive.?

Brizuela won the IBF Latino title by defeating countryman Julio Cesar Ruiz by a twelve round unanimous decision on Augist 13, 2011.

Daud who fought as a featherweight for some eight years has indicated he feels more comfortable with his new weight and wants to answer his critics. He told the Jakarta Globe ?I feel more comfortable as I can?t stay in featherweight class. I want to win this bout, either with decision or knockout.?

Daud won the IBO featherweight title with a stunning 2nd round knockout of hard-hitting Filipino Lorenzo Villanueva at the Marina Bay Sands Hotel on May 5, 2012.

Yordan has a record of 30-3 with 23 knockouts.
